Thank you for your interest in Temple Adath Israel’s Religious School! Our school is based on the premise that our spiritual world rests on Torah (study), Avodah (worship), and G’milut Chasadim (acts of loving kindness). We are committed to providing a warm, exciting, vibrant, and nurturing environment for our students. We work with parents and teachers to help our students:

  • Develop a positive Jewish identity
  • Apply Jewish ethical beliefs to daily life
  • Gain a fundamental knowledge and understanding of Jewish practice, history, and language.

TAI Religious School welcomes students from 4-years-old to 10th grade.  We partner with the Institute of Southern Jewish Life (ISJL) and utilize their curriculum, which includes 10 key content areas:  Community, Culture and Symbols, God, Hebrew and Prayer, Israel, Jewish History, Jewish Holidays, Jewish Lifecycle Events, Mitzvot and Jewish Values, and TaNaKh (Torah, Prophets, and Writings). Beginning in 3rd grade, weekly instruction begins with a 45-60 minute Hebrew lesson followed by our Jewish Values curriculum. We are also extremely proud of our enrichment activities, which include art, garden, library, music & movement, and Rabbi Time.

Our students’ engagement in Jewish life does not stop with Religious School. TAI students are encouraged to participate in Jewish Lifecycle Events including Consecration, Bar/Bat Mitzvah, and Confirmation. We host a monthly Family Shabbat Service and we observe and celebrate Jewish holidays together as a school and congregation. Students of all ages are invited to join our Junior Choir, Middle and High School students are encouraged to participate in Youth Group, and our post-Confirmation class is welcomed back to the school as Madrichim, assisting in a variety of important roles.
